How many years did Burj Khalifa take to build?

Construction of the Burj Khalifa began in 2004, with the exterior completed five years later in 2009. The primary structure is reinforced concrete. The building was opened in 2010 as part of a new development called Downtown Dubai.

What is the highest floor in Burj Khalifa?

The Burj Khalifa, Dubai has 163 floors above the ground. But none of the floors above the 124th are occupied. The 124th floor has an outdoor observation deck, the highest in the world.

Were the twin towers the tallest buildings in the world?

At the time of their completion, the Twin Towers — the original 1 World Trade Center, at 1,368 feet (417 m); and 2 World Trade Center, at 1,362 feet (415.1 m) — were the tallest buildings in the world.

Is Skyscraper a real building?

A skyscraper is a continuously habitable high-rise building that has over 40 floors and is taller than approximately 150 m (492 ft).

How many people died building the Titanic?

Titanica! Eight Harland and Wolff workers were killed during the construction of the Titanic five of whom have been identified. In addition to the fatalities there were 28 serious accidents and 218 minor accidents recorded by the firm.

Will there be a taller building than the Burj Khalifa?

Developers have announced plans to build a new tower in Dubai to surpass the Burj Khalifa, currently the world’s tallest building. Emaar Properties has not announced the height of the proposed tower, saying only that it would be “a notch” taller than the Burj Khalifa’s 828m (2,717ft).

What does Burj Khalifa mean?

‘Burj Khalifa’ is a megastructure and the world’s tallest skyscraper standing in Dubai, UAE. Literally, it consist of the two Arabic words. ‘Burj’ means a building or a standing structure or a tower and ‘Khalifa’ is the surname of UAE’s king, Sheikh Khalifa bin Zayed al-Nahayan.
